Call To Missouri Women For Union In 1915 Conference
The Illinois Federation of Colored Women's Clubs calls Missouri women to join a Western States compact to improve religious social and civic conditions and protest unfair laws. Missouri representatives named include Minnie Crosthwait Lucinda Day and many others across Kansas City Lexington Jefferson City and St. Louis. The conference dates August 16 1915 at St Mark's A M E Church Chicago Haole coincide with the Lincoln Jubilee and National Half Century Exposition.

Barber Shop Expands As Loyal Patrons Help Grow Jones Trade
John A Jones thanks friends and patrons in Kansas City Sun for four years of support. He remodeled his barber shop and billiard parlor, notes growth and improved services, and emphasizes a sober, reliable staff. He recalls starting as a white trade barber twenty seven years ago and aims to serve the race with progressive, clean, high quality entertainment and grooming.

Shriner Week at the Criterion Theatre Opens With Fun
Allah Temple No 6 Shriners present a week of entertainment at the Criterion Theatre 18th and Highland starting Monday the 12th. Featuring moving pictures a Shrine minstrel show and a lively bones and tambourine act with notable Mason and Shrine figures as potential interlocutors. Tickets are 15 cents good for any night.

Fortunes Unequal Pay Noted After Louisiana Trip
Mra Fannie Parker returned from an extended Louisiana trip visiting New Orleans and Centerville. She urges reflection on gender pay disparity noting men earn 65 cents while women receive 25 cents per day without board.
